    Accessibility Standards

    We aim to conform to the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2.1 Level AA standards. These guidelines help make web content more accessible to people with a wide range of disabilities, including:

    • Visual impairments (blindness, low vision, color blindness)
    • Hearing impairments
    • Motor impairments
    • Cognitive and learning disabilities

    Accessibility Features

    Our platform includes the following accessibility features:

    Keyboard Navigation

    All interactive elements can be accessed using keyboard-only navigation.

    Screen Reader Compatibility

    Content is structured with semantic HTML and ARIA labels for screen reader users.

    Color Contrast

    Text and interface elements meet WCAG contrast ratio requirements.

    Resizable Text

    Text can be resized up to 200% without loss of content or functionality.

    Focus Indicators

    Visible focus indicators help keyboard users track their position on the page.

    Alternative Text

    Images include descriptive alternative text for screen readers.

    Supported Assistive Technologies

    Our platform is designed to work with:

    • Screen readers (NVDA, JAWS, VoiceOver, TalkBack)
    • Screen magnification software
    • Speech recognition software
    • Keyboard-only navigation
    • Switch devices and alternative input methods
